Mark 12:41-44 (GOS-12)

She contributed all she had, her whole livelihood.

A reading from the holy Gospel according to Mark.

Jesus sat down opposite the treasury
and observed how the crowd put money into the treasury.
Many rich people put in large sums.
A poor widow also came
and put in two small coins worth a few cents.
Calling his disciples to himself, he said to them,
“Amen, I say to you, this poor widow
put in more than all the other contributors to the treasury.
For they have all contributed from their surplus wealth,
but she, from her poverty,
has contributed all she had, her whole livelihood.”

The Gospel of the Lord.
